Tips for Finding Quality Listings

Finding quality listings on Craigslist involves a strategic approach. Utilizing the search platform effectively ensures access to the best vehicles.

Using Filters Effectively

Filters serve as essential tools for narrowing down search results. Buyers benefit by setting criteria like price range, make, model, and location. These specifications streamline the search process and save time. Selecting “private owner” in the listing options limits ads to personal sellers. This helps eliminate dealership listings, enhancing the chances of discovering unique finds. Buyers should regularly check listings, as inventory changes frequently. Adjusting filters based on newly listed vehicles can unveil hidden opportunities.

Conducting a Test Drive

Test driving a vehicle proves essential in assessing its condition. Buyers should steer the car on various road types to evaluate performance. Engaging the brakes and testing acceleration helps spot any mechanical problems. Listening for unusual noises during the drive can signal underlying issues. Also, check how the vehicle handles turns and bumps, as this can reveal suspension concerns. Taking time to analyze comfort and visibility ensures the vehicle meets personal preferences. Every detail observed during this process contributes to informed decision-making.

Checking Vehicle History Reports

Vehicle history reports provide crucial information about a car’s past. Review documents from reputable services like Carfax or AutoCheck before finalizing a purchase. Data on previous accidents, title status, and maintenance records paints a complete picture of reliability. Inspect the report for odometer reading discrepancies, which may indicate fraud. Additionally, checking for any recalls is essential to ensure safety compliance. Being aware of the vehicle’s history can help buyers avoid future problems. A clear understanding of a vehicle’s background aids in negotiations and enhances trust in the purchase process.
